What is the Difference between Translation and Transliteration?
Translation refers to the meaning of a sentence or word in another language, for instance - “I am eating right now” will be translated to “je mange en ce moment” in French.
Transliteration, on the other hand, is the process of writing a language using a different alphabet, making it much easier to read a language. For instance - “Tō tamē lōkō kēma chō” will be transliterated to “તો તમે લોકો કેમ છો” in Gujrati.
Transliteration does not carry over the meaning, it focuses only on the characters.
